a {
    font-family: "Century Gothic" "Verdana" "Arial";
    font-size: 15px;
    color: #66CC66;
    font-weight: normal;
    text-decoration: none;
    text-align: right;
}
a:hover {
    color: #C6E3C5;
}
a:active {
    color: #67CC66;
}
.acourant {
    font-family: "Century Gothic" "Verdana" "Arial";
    color: #008000;
    font-size: 15px;
    font-weight: normal;
    text-decoration: none;
}
.classtxt {
    font-family: "Century Gothic" "Verdana" "Arial";
    font-size: 15px;
    font-weight: normal;
    color: #338B62;
    text-align: center;
}
.classcidre {
    font-family: "Century Gothic" "Verdana" "Arial";
    font-size: 14px;
    font-weight: normal;
    color: #338B62;
    text-align: justify;
}
body
{
    background-color: #FFFFFF;
}
#a_chambres {
    position:absolute;
    width:200px;
    height:22px;
    z-index:1;
    left: 284px;
    top: 48px;
}
#a_chevaux {
    position:absolute;
    width:200px;
    height:22px;
    z-index:1;
    left: 510px;
    top: 48px;
}
#a_cidrerie {
    position:absolute;
    width:200px;
    height:22px;
    z-index:1;
    left: 736px;
    top: 48px;
}
#a_contact {
    position:absolute;
    width:150px;
    height:22px;
    z-index:1;
    left: 100px;
    top: 130px;
}
#a_chambre01 {
    position:absolute;
    width:150px;
    height:22px;
    z-index:1;
    left: 284px;
    top: 130px;
}
#a_chambre02 {
    position:absolute;
    width:150px;
    height:22px;
    z-index:1;
    left: 510px;
    top: 130px;
}
#a_chambre03 {
    position:absolute;
    width:200px;
    height:22px;
    z-index:1;
    left: 736px;
    top: 130px;
}
#a_pommiers {
    position:absolute;
    width:150px;
    height:22px;
    z-index:1;
    left: 284px;
    top: 130px;
}
#a_production {
    position:absolute;
    width:150px;
    height:22px;
    z-index:1;
    left: 510px;
    top: 130px;
}
#a_box {
    position:absolute;
    width:150px;
    height:22px;
    z-index:1;
    left: 284px;
    top: 130px;
}
#a_manege {
    position:absolute;
    width:150px;
    height:22px;
    z-index:1;
    left: 510px;
    top: 130px;
}
#fond {
    position:relative;
    width:955px;
    height:600px;
    z-index:0;
    background-color: #FFFFFF;
}
#espanol {
    position:absolute;
    width:20px;
    height:13px;
    z-index:3;
    left: 854px;
    top: 10px;
    cursor:pointer;
    cursor:hand;
}
#ingles {
    position:absolute;
    width:20px;
    height:13px;
    z-index:3;
    left: 894px;
    top: 10px;
    cursor:pointer;
    cursor:hand;
}
#frances {
    position:absolute;
    width:20px;
    height:13px;
    z-index:3;
    left: 934px;
    top: 10px;
    cursor:pointer;
    cursor:hand;
}
#logo {
    position:absolute;
    width:284px;
    height:70px;
    z-index:1;
    left: 0px;
    top: 20px;
}
#adresse {
    position:absolute;
    width:284px;
    height:70px;
    z-index:1;
    left: 0px;
    top: 0px;
    font-family: "Century Gothic" "Verdana" "Arial";
    color: #338B62;
    font-size: 12px;
    font-weight: normal;
    text-decoration: none;
    line-height: 130%;
}
#beltzenia {
    position:absolute;
    width:284px;
    height:70px;
    z-index:1;
    left: 0px;
    top: 60px;
}
#entete01 {
    position:absolute;
    width:200px;
    height:50px;
    z-index:1;
    left: 284px;
    top: 74px;
}
#entete02 {
    position:absolute;
    width:200px;
    height:50px;
    z-index:1;
    left: 510px;
    top: 74px;
}
#entete03 {
    position:absolute;
    width:200px;
    height:50px;
    z-index:1;
    left: 736px;
    top: 74px;
}
#entete {
    position:absolute;
    width:670px;
    height:50px;
    z-index:1;
    left: 284px;
    top: 74px;
}
#presentation {
    position:absolute;
    width:352px;
    height:432px;
    z-index:4;
    left: 78px;
    top: 208px;
    font-family: "Century Gothic" "Verdana" "Arial";
    font-size: 14px;
    font-weight: normal;
    color: #006F3C;
    text-align: justify;
    padding-right: 10px;
    overflow : auto;
}
#gites {
    position:absolute;
    width:65px;
    height:65px;
    z-index:3;
    left: 78px;
    top: 620px;
    cursor:pointer;
    cursor:hand;
}
#l_resa {
    position:absolute;
    width:200px;
    height:22px;
    z-index:1;
    left: 145px;
    top: 644px;
}
#map {
    position:absolute;
    width:600px;
    height:440px;
    z-index:1;
    left: 0px;
    top: 182px;
}
#contacto {
    position:absolute;
    width:314px;
    height:340px;
    z-index:4;
    left: 620px;
    top: 280px;
    font-family: "Century Gothic" "Verdana" "Arial";
    font-size: 15px;
    font-weight: normal;
    color: #338B62;
    overflow : auto;
}
#direccion {
    position:absolute;
    width:354px;
    height:200px;
    z-index:4;
    left: 600px;
    top: 182px;
    font-family: "Century Gothic" "Verdana" "Arial";
    font-size: 15px;
    font-weight: bold;
    color: #338B62;
    text-align: center;
}
#txt_cidre {
    position:absolute;
    width:384px;
    height:520px;
    z-index:4;
    left: 570px;
    top: 202px;
}
#txt_chambres {
    position:absolute;
    width:319px;
    height:403px;
    z-index:4;
    left: 635px;
    top: 202px;
}
#txt_production {
    position:absolute;
    width:319px;
    height:443px;
    z-index:4;
    left: 635px;
    top: 172px;
}
#txt_judor {
    position:absolute;
    width:294px;
    height:400px;
    z-index:4;
    left: 660px;
    top: 202px;
    text-align: justify;
}
#txt_mozolo {
    position:absolute;
    width:470px;
    height:400px;
    z-index:4;
    left: 510px;
    top: 202px;
    text-align: justify;
}
#txt_txalaka {
    position:absolute;
    width:324px;
    height:400px;
    z-index:4;
    left: 630px;
    top: 202px;
    text-align: justify;
}
#myGallery, #myGallerySet, #flickrGallery
{
    position:absolute;
    width:400px;
    height:498px;
    left: 536px;
    top: 182px;
}
#myGalleryChevaux
{
    position:absolute;
    width:610px;
    height:415px;
    z-index:1;
    left: 0px;
    top: 182px;
}
#myGalleryPommes
{
    position:absolute;
    width:615px;
    height:443px;
    z-index:1;
    left: 0px;
    top: 182px;
}
#myGalleryJudor
{
    position:absolute;
    width:640px;
    height:440px;
    z-index:1;
    left: 0px;
    top: 182px;
}
#myGalleryMozolo
{
    position:absolute;
    width:490px;
    height:440px;
    z-index:1;
    left: 0px;
    top: 182px;
}
#myGalleryTxalaka
{
    position:absolute;
    width:610px;
    height:440px;
    z-index:1;
    left: 0px;
    top: 182px;
}
#myGalleryCidre
{
    position:absolute;
    width:550px;
    height:520px;
    z-index:1;
    left: 0px;
    top: 182px;
}

